> This breaks compatibility with existing DTB files.
> What you probably want is to make sure that any clocks with parent name
> of "cxo", should have a .fw_name = "cxo", then you can make a
> phandle-based reference in DT and these global names doesn't matter (and
> in the end we can remove this board_clk from the driver).
Ah, I see. If I understand correctly, it should be something like this,
right?
